微控制器的串列埠傳送中斷程式10

發布 科技 2024-05-18
9個回答
  1. 匿名使用者2024-02-10

    初始化三個中斷,x0 x1 t2。

    T2 由 x0 啟動,以定期和週期傳送序列資料;

    T2 由 x1 關閉。

  2. 匿名使用者2024-02-09

    這似乎必須得到乙個主程式,你必須有乙個從程式。

  3. 匿名使用者2024-02-08

    串列埠傳送請求中斷時間,串列埠傳送也與電子元器件有關,所以串列埠傳送請求中斷時間,那麼只有在網路上才能到達串列埠傳送請求中斷時間,其他無法到達串列埠,在中途傳送此請求。

    中斷就像乙個後台操作,在主程式的程序中,不需要刻意去注意中斷方式是否傳送、何時接收等,查詢方法是在主程式程序中不斷檢查資料是否已經接收到,一般使用while來連續檢查乙個迴圈。

    中斷模式可以更有效地利用CPU,節省CPU的時間,查詢會增加CPU的負擔。

    起源。 串列埠出現在1980年左右,資料傳輸速率為115kbps至230kbps。 早期,串列埠用於連線計算機外圍裝置,通常用於連線滑鼠和外部數據機,以及老式的相機和剪貼簿。

    串列埠也可用於兩台計算機(或裝置)之間的互連和資料傳輸。

    由於串列埠(COM)不支援熱插拔,傳輸速率低,一些新主機板和大部分膝上型電腦已經開始去掉凳子介面。 串列埠多用於工業控制和測量裝置以及一些通訊裝置。

  4. 匿名使用者2024-02-07

    不知道你說的是哪個系列的微控制器。 以下是 51 個微控制器的彙編和 C 語言中清除中斷的宣告。 彙編:

    clr ie0 ;清除此 int0 請求標誌的外部中斷分散核心 clr ie1 ; 清除外部中斷 int1 請求標誌 clr tf0 ; 清除定時器 t0 中斷請求標誌 clr tf1 ; 清除計時器 T1 中斷請求標誌 CLR RI; 序列通訊接收中斷請求標誌 CLR TI ; 串列埠通訊傳送中斷請求標誌 c 語言:ie0=0; 清除外部中斷 int0 請求標誌 ie1=0; 清除外部中斷 int1 請求標誌 tf0=0; 清除固定脈衝定時器 t0 tf1=0 的中斷請求標誌; 清除定時器 t1 中斷請求標誌 ri=0; 串列埠通訊接收中斷請求標誌 ti=0; 序列通訊傳送中斷請求。

    我認為它很有用,豎起大拇指。

  5. 匿名使用者2024-02-06

    需要響應外部事件的裝置使用微控制器中斷介面。

    MCU中斷是指在執行主程式的過程中,當發生特定事件時,MCU自動暫停主程式的執行,跳轉到相應的中斷服務程式執行。 這種機制可以有效提高單片胡風機處理外部事件的能力和效率,因此被廣泛應用於需要快速響應事件的嵌入式裝置中。 例如,智慧型家居、醫療裝置、工業控制、汽車電子等領域的裝置往往需要使用中斷介面來處理各種事件,如輸入訊號、感測器資料、通訊協議等。

    總之,微控制器中斷介面是嵌入式系統的重要組成部分,廣泛應用於需要快速響應外部事件的各種裝置中。 不同型別的裝置需要使用不同的中斷介面,因此在設計或使用裝置時,需要根據具體需要選擇合適的微控制器、中斷裝置和軟體驅動程式,以確保裝置的效能和穩定性。

  6. 匿名使用者2024-02-05

    設定就是表示你想讓CPU做什麼,只要CPU去做這個設定,它就沒用了,因為它已經幹了。 中斷只是優先順序更高的程式,程式不是沒有編寫的,而是已經包含的,但您不必自己編寫。

  7. 匿名使用者2024-02-04

    傳送資料時不使用中斷,只需在接收資料時使用中斷。 通常情況就是這樣。

  8. 匿名使用者2024-02-03

    首先,不允許使用太長的中斷處理程式。

    實際上,進入中斷,關閉中斷,處理,然後再次開啟中斷。 也有辦法解決這個問題。

    嘗試使用標誌來縮短處理函式。

    中斷-中斷功能(interrupt-interrupt function(interrupt-interrupt function)),以便重新進入,直到微控制器資源耗盡為止。

  9. 匿名使用者2024-02-02

    它不會被自動丟棄,而是被重複接收,導致以後的資料被第乙個接收和未處理的資料覆蓋。

    例如,如果對方給你發了乙個字串 0x x x03,如果你中斷函式太多,你可能會在將0x01從緩衝區中取出並在處理過程中收到 0x x03,那麼0x03會覆蓋0x02,導致你下次進入串列埠中斷功能時只能取出0x03。

    因此,中斷功能必須簡潔高效,只要不是火燒火的判斷過程,就應該扔進主迴圈或常規任務。

    此外,現在很多微控制器串列埠都有硬體FIFO,好好利用FIFO也會大大提高整個系統的中斷效率。

相關回答
4個回答2024-05-18

你的發光二極體是怎麼連線的,如果有電源串在發光二極體上,低電平會導通,如果是微控制器的輸出口,則不會導通。

4個回答2024-05-18

你使用乙個P1埠來控制8個數碼管的動態掃瞄,數碼管的動態掃瞄顯示需要被遮蔽。 >>>More

5個回答2024-05-18

您好:我編寫了程式:

#include >>>More

18個回答2024-05-18

房東,組織 0030h。

你怎麼理解我的意思? >>>More

2個回答2024-05-18

總結。 親愛的,請告訴我具體問題。

親愛的,請告訴我具體問題。 >>>More